Overview
As part of the M2P Engineering team, this role provides Tier 2 support and engineering expertise for MAM and post-production platforms within a virtualized hybrid on-premises and cloud environment.
Responsibilities
- Manage tickets escalated from Level 0 and Level 1 support teams.
- Coordinate incident and problem follow-up with internal and external teams.
- Follow up and update on platform day-to-day with the support Tier 1.
- Plan maintenance activities.
- Coordinate upgrade phases and reboot actions.
- Monitor and maintain the overall health and performance of the platform.
- Manage short-term engineering projects.
- Collaborate with tier 3 engineering team.
- Gather workflow requirements from WBD Sports, TNT Sports and Eurosport offices.
- Produce workflow, project and engineering documentation.
- Design centralized workflows across MAM and Post-Production platforms.
- Support users through change management and new projects implementation.
Qualifications
- Degree in Technology, Engineering, Broadcast, or a related field.
- Fluent written and spoken English. French language skills are desirable.
- Strong communication skills.
- Adaptability to work in a fast-paced and continuously changing environment.
- Ability to perform effectively under pressure, particularly when supporting production teams during live events.
- Self-motivated and collaborative team player with a strong commitment to delivering high-quality customer service.
- Excellent troubleshooting, analytical and problem-solving skills.
- Minimum of 3 years of experience in Broadcast Technology in a support or engineering role.
- Experience in Sports, News, Production and Documentary environments.
- Experience with MAM and Post-Production tools.
- Extensive Broadcast technical background (IP video 2110, AES 67, NMOS, video and audio formats and codec).
- Good understanding of IT technologies and associated challenges (network, virtualization, storage, cloud services, security).
- Monitor emerging technologies and industry trends to ensure systems remain efficient, scalable and aligned with business growth.
- Nice to have: Basic scripting and development skills.
- Knowledge of AWS services.
- Knowledge of microservices architecture.
